Main Facts: A Convergence of Mediterranean Staples
The Gluten-Free Lemon Olive Oil Cake is defined by its departure from the traditional butter-and-wheat-flour model. Instead, it relies on a trio of foundational Mediterranean ingredients: extra virgin olive oil, almond flour, and citrus.

The Foundation of Texture
Unlike standard cakes that rely on gluten for structure, this recipe utilizes the density of almond flour and the "bite" of fine polenta. The result is a crumb that is described as "pleasantly dense and slightly grainy," yet remarkably moist. The inclusion of polenta provides a structural scaffolding that prevents the cake from collapsing, a common failure in gluten-free baking.

Flavor Profile and Balance
The cake is engineered to provide a multi-dimensional lemon experience. Rather than relying solely on extract, the recipe incorporates lemon at three distinct levels:

- The Batter: Fresh lemon juice and zest provide the internal aromatic core.
- The Topping: A whipped mascarpone cream infused with zest offers a tangy, fatty contrast.
- The Garnish: Candied lemon rinds provide a concentrated, bittersweet finish.

Chronology: The Technical Execution of the Recipe
The production of this cake is a multi-stage process that requires precise timing and temperature management. The following chronology outlines the steps necessary to achieve the "best thing I’ve ever made" status reported by the recipe’s developer.

Phase I: Preparation of the Candied Elements
The process begins not with the batter, but with the garnish. Candying lemon rinds is a transformative process that removes the acrid bitterness of the pith.

- Blanching: The lemon strips are blanched in boiling water three times. This repetitive process is crucial; it softens the cell walls of the rind and flushes out the bitter compounds.
- Syrup Reduction: The blanched rinds are then simmered in a 1:1 sugar-water syrup for 15 to 20 minutes until the liquid caramelizes. This creates a translucent, jewel-like garnish that adds visual and textural complexity.
Phase II: Emulsifying the Batter
While the oven preheats to 350 F, the baker focuses on the aeration of the eggs.

- Aeration: Large eggs and sugar are beaten for 3 to 4 minutes. This is not merely mixing; it is an act of mechanical leavening. The goal is a "pale and slightly thickened" consistency that provides the initial lift for the cake.
- The Olive Oil Stream: Extra virgin olive oil is slowly streamed into the egg mixture. This creates a stable emulsion, ensuring the fat is evenly distributed so the cake doesn’t feel greasy.
Phase III: Integration of Dry Ingredients
The dry components—almond flour, fine polenta, baking powder, and kosher salt—are whisked together before being folded into the wet ingredients.

- Folding: Over-mixing is a common pitfall. The recipe specifies "folding until just combined" to preserve the air bubbles created during the egg-beating phase.
- Inclusion of Pistachios: Toasted pistachios are added at the final stage of folding, providing a salty, nutty counterpoint to the bright citrus.
Phase IV: Baking and Cooling
The batter is poured into a 9-inch round pan greased with olive oil and lined with parchment. The cake is baked for 35 to 40 minutes. The cooling process is two-tiered: 10 minutes in the pan to allow the structure to set, followed by a complete cool on a wire rack to prevent the bottom from becoming soggy.

Phase V: The Mascarpone Finish
The final stage involves whipping mascarpone, heavy cream, powdered sugar, and lemon zest. The instruction "do not overbeat" is critical here; mascarpone has a high fat content and can quickly turn to butter if over-agitated. The cream is then piped or spread onto the cooled cake and garnished with the prepared candied rinds and rosemary sprigs.

Supporting Data: The Science of Substitutions
The success of this recipe lies in the specific choice of ingredients, particularly the distinction between polenta and cornmeal, and the choice of fat.

Polenta vs. Cornmeal: The Granularity Factor
A common misconception in gluten-free baking is that all ground corn products are interchangeable. As noted in the supporting data, the difference lies in the milling:

- Cornmeal: Typically ground finer, behaving more like a traditional powder. This can lead to a dense, bread-like crumb.
- Fine Polenta: An Italian-style grind that is coarser and more granular. This allows the grain to absorb moisture without losing its identity, resulting in the "airy yet grainy" crumb that defines this specific cake.
The Chemistry of Olive Oil in Baking
Unlike butter, which is approximately 15-20% water, olive oil is 100% fat. This means that olive oil cakes remain moist for much longer than butter-based cakes. Additionally, the polyphenols in extra virgin olive oil act as a natural preservative, while its liquid state at room temperature ensures the cake never feels "hard" or "stiff" when served cold.

Nutritional Breakdown (Per Serving)
| Nutrient | Amount |
|---|---|
| Calories | 787 |
| Total Fat | 52.5 g |
| Saturated Fat | 11.3 g |
| Cholesterol | 106.8 mg |
| Total Carbohydrates | 74.6 g |
| Dietary Fiber | 5.8 g |
| Protein | 12.0 g |

Adaptability as a Design Feature
The developer provides official guidance on adaptations, noting that while the recipe is optimized for lemon, it is a robust framework for other citrus fruits.

- Citrus Variations: Blood orange or Meyer lemons can be used in equal quantities.
- Alternative Toppings: For a lighter profile, Prints suggests replacing the mascarpone with Greek yogurt and a drizzle of honey, maintaining the Mediterranean flavor profile while reducing the caloric density.

The Rise of "Alt-Flours"
By using almond flour and polenta, this recipe moves away from "all-purpose gluten-free flour blends" which often rely on starches (potato, tapioca) that lack nutritional value and flavor. The implication is that the future of baking lies in "naturally" gluten-free ingredients that bring their own unique organoleptic properties to the table.
